Description

2,3,6-Trifluoroisonicotinic Acid is a high-value fluorinated pyridine derivative, serving as a critical building block in advanced organic synthesis. Its unique trifluorinated structure offers enhanced metabolic stability and lipophilicity, making it indispensable for developing novel active compounds. This intermediate is primarily sought after by pharmaceutical and agrochemical research organizations for the creation of next-generation products.

Application

  • Pharmaceutical Intermediate: A key synthon for the development of active pharmaceutical ingredients (APIs), particularly in kinase inhibitor and antiviral drug discovery programs.
  • Agrochemical Synthesis: Used in the research and production of advanced herbicides and pesticides, where the fluorine atoms contribute to biological activity and environmental persistence.
  • Ligand and Catalyst Development: Serves as a precursor for creating specialized ligands in transition metal catalysis and organocatalysis.
  • Material Science Research: Employed in the synthesis of fluorinated organic electronic materials and liquid crystals.

Basic Information

Product Name 2,3,6-Trifluoroisonicotinic Acid
CAS No. 675602-92-3
Molecular Formula C6H2F3NO2
Molecular Weight 177.08 g/mol
Synonyms 2,3,6-Trifluoropyridine-4-carboxylic Acid; 4-Pyridinecarboxylic Acid, 2,3,6-Trifluoro-; 2,3,6-Trifluoro-4-pyridinecarboxylic Acid; 2,3,6-Trifluoropyridine-4-carboxylic Acid; 2,3,6-Trifluoroisonicotinic Acid; 675602-92-3; Trifluorinated Isonicotinic Acid Der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ong bases and oxidizing agents. Due to its acidic nature, appropriate chemical handling procedures should be followed.
